Role Overview

Insights Directors at Escalent lead the development of insights and storytelling and own the data analysis and reporting phases of our work.

There is a parallel path of roles called Project Management that focuses on the project logistics, timing and budget.

At Escalent, the Director of Insights is a leadership role, supervising other Insights professionals while also playing a senior-level project role. This role helps the Sector leader fulfill on the objectives for projects while maintaining strong client relationships. Depending on the account team�s size and needs, this role may take the lead on day-to-day project related decisions and client correspondence. Insights Directors contribute to client retention and growth through consistent responsiveness and delivery of high-quality insights.

Insights & Consulting positions are accountable for:
  • Presenting insights that address the client or industry�s needs.
  • Proper application of analytical techniques & tools
  • Creating client-ready materials on time
  • Sound process & integrity of insights
